A Comprehensive Guide to Buying Yorkiepoo Puppies: What You Need to Know
Yorkiepoos, a wonderful crossbreed in between Yorkshire Terriers and Poodles, have gotten tremendous popularity over the years. Their lovable appearances, spirited nature, and hypoallergenic qualities make them a preferred amongst canine enthusiasts. If you’re considering adding a Yorkiepoo to your family, it’s important to comprehend what to look for in a puppy, where to buy them, and how to make sure that you are making the very best decision for your future furry friend.
What to Expect From YorkiepoosLook and Size
Yorkiepoos are small dogs with a charming look that can vary considerably depending upon their hereditary makeup. Generally, they weigh between 4 to 15 pounds and stand about 7 to 15 inches tall. Their coats can be wavy, curly, or straight and frequently been available in various colors, including black, brown, and white.
Character
Yorkiepoos are understood for their lively and caring personality. They are smart, social, and eager to please, making them terrific companions for families, songs, and elders alike. However, their spirited character requires routine socializing and training to ensure they turn into well-behaved grownups.
Life expectancy and Health
Usually, Yorkiepoos live in between 12 to 15 years. Being a hybrid type, they can inherit health concerns typical to their parent breeds. Potential health concerns consist of:

When you’ve decided to buy a Yorkiepoo puppy, preparation is crucial to making sure a smooth shift for your new animal. Here’s a list of things to consider:

Supplies: Before bringing your puppy home, ensure you have:
Food and water bowlsPremium pet dog foodLeash and collarCrate for trainingChew toysGrooming tools (brush, nail clippers)
Home Environment: Puppy-proof your home by getting rid of any dangers. Guarantee that there are no poisonous plants, exposed wires, Yorkie mini or choking threats within your puppy’s reach.

Vet Visits: Schedule a visit with a vet right after bringing your Yorkiepoo home. Routine check-ups, vaccinations, and preventive care are vital for their wellness.

Training and Socialization: Start training your Yorkiepoo early. Favorable reinforcement strategies work best with this breed. Socialization with other dogs and individuals throughout their early months is important to establish a well-adjusted adult pet.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How much do Yorkiepoo puppies cost?
Yorkiepoo puppies usually range in cost from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 3,000, depending on factors such as breeder track record, area, and whether the puppy is registered.
2. Are Yorkiepoos hypoallergenic?
Yes, Yorkiepoos are frequently considered hypoallergenic due to their Poodle family tree, making them an ideal alternative for individuals with allergic reactions.
3. Just how much workout do Yorkiepoos need?
Yorkiepoos need moderate exercise, consisting of day-to-day walks and playtime. About 30 minutes to an hour of physical activity is perfect to keep them happy and healthy.
4. Are Yorkiepoos good with children?
When effectively interacted socially, Yorkiepoos can be great buddies for kids. However, guidance is important due to their small size.
5. How often do Yorkiepoos require grooming?
Yorkiepoos require routine grooming, at least every 4-6 weeks, to maintain their coat and prevent matting.
